    Technical Interview Guide for Deep Learning Engineers

    Use these questions to evaluate candidates during your interviews.

    Technical Questions

    • • Design a neural architecture for a problem with both tabular features and image inputs. How would you combine these modalities and what fusion strategies would you consider?
    • • Explain the attention mechanism in transformers from first principles. How does self-attention differ from cross-attention, and what are the computational complexity implications?
    • • You're training a deep neural network and see the training loss decreasing but validation loss increasing. Walk through your systematic debugging process.
    • • How would you design a training pipeline for a model that requires 100 GPU-hours? What distributed training strategies would you use and how would you handle checkpointing?
    • • Explain your approach to neural architecture search. When is NAS worth the computational cost, and what search strategies have you found effective?
    • • You need to reduce a 2B parameter model to run on edge devices with 500MB memory. What compression techniques would you apply and in what order?

    Cultural Fit Questions

    • • Tell me about a deep learning project where you had to design a novel architecture. What was your hypothesis, how did you iterate, and what did you learn?
    • • How do you stay current with the rapidly evolving DL research landscape? What recent paper have you found impactful for your work?
    • • Describe a situation where a simpler model outperformed a complex deep learning approach. How do you decide when DL is and isn't appropriate?
    • • When training experiments are taking longer than expected and stakeholders are pressuring for results, how do you balance thoroughness with delivery speed?
